asp.net生成的word为什么总提示需要转码错误

问题描述

通过修改注册表就可以不出现提示,可让每个使用的客户端都修改注册表太麻烦吧?stringname="CNSI.doc";objectfilename="C://"+name;stringcontent;MSWord.ApplicationwordApp;MSWord.DocumentwordDoc;wordApp=newMSWord.ApplicationClass();Objectnothing=Missing.Value;wordDoc=wordApp.Documents.Add(refnothing,refnothing,refnothing,refnothing);content="这一行是14号字体的文本"+"n"+"sdfsf"+"n"+"sdfsfd";wordDoc.Paragraphs.Last.Range.Font.Size=15;wordDoc.Paragraphs.Last.Range.Text=content;wordDoc.SaveAs(reffilename,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ing,refnothing);wordDoc.Close(refnothing,refnothing,refnothing);wordApp.Quit(refnothing,refnothing,refnothing);

时间: 2024-09-29 04:57:42

asp.net生成的word为什么总提示需要转码错误的相关文章

怎样让Word 2010 不提示所谓的语法错误

在日常工作生活中,我们利用Word2010写文档时,可能会用到一些自创词语.英文词汇等,这些不规范的词语经常会被Office认定为错误拼写而为你报错,在词汇下方标注红色或绿色的波浪下划线,很影响阅读和美观. 那么,如何去掉这些让人讨厌的波浪下划线呢?如果不希望Word 2010用红色或绿色的波浪线把文档中的拼写或语法错误标识出来,可以在"Word选项"对话框中关闭.下面我们就来详细讲解下在word2010中如何关闭拼写和语法错误标记的方法. Word2007/2010开启Word语法错

ASP输出生成Word 、Excel、Txt文件的方法

  在ASP中生成Word文件.Excel文件和Txt文件,参考了微软的官方文档,自己简单弄了下,基本可以实现了,不足之处,望指导!下面言归正传. 1.用ASP生成Word文档,代码示例:     用这种方法生成的Word文档,有时候会出现一个提示:"Microsoft Office Word 需要转换器以正确显示该文件.这项功能目前尚未安装,是否现在安装?",这时候重新安装SKU011.CAB就可以了,原因不明. 2.ASP生成Excel文档:   3.ASP生成Txt文档,这个最简

ASP+模板生成Word、Excel、html的代码第1/2页_应用技巧

大多数都是采用Excel.Application(http://www.blueidea.com/tech/program/2006/3547.asp)组件来生成发现容易出错,而且对于大多数和我一样的菜鸟来说,比较麻烦,考虑到前些天用ASP+模板+adodb.stream生成静态页面的办法,经过多次尝试,终于掌握了一种用ASP+模板生成Excel和word的新的办法,先分享如下:  用模板生成Excel.Word最大优点:         Word.Excel文档样式易于控制和调整,以往用Exc

ASP+模板生成Word、Excel、html的代码第1/2页

大多数都是采用Excel.Application(http://www.blueidea.com/tech/program/2006/3547.asp)组件来生成 发现容易出错,而且对于大多数和我一样的菜鸟来说,比较麻烦,考虑到前些天用ASP+模板+adodb.stream生成静态页面的办法,经过多次尝试,终于掌握了一种用ASP+模板生成Excel和word的新的办法,先分享如下: 用模板生成Excel.Word最大优点: Word.Excel文档样式易于控制和调整,以往用Excel.Appli

vs2012打开总提示asp.net4.5尚未在Web服务器注册。您需要。。。

问题描述 vs2012打开总提示asp.net4.5尚未在Web服务器注册.您需要... 解决方案 先搜索一下,其实大部份问题网上其他人都有遇到过,有些网上已经有解决方法了. CSDN网就有 http://bbs.csdn.net/topics/390992746

asp中如何用word模板生成pdf文件

问题描述 asp.net,用word模板生成pdf文件,求源码或者例子 解决方案 解决方案二:有人知道吗??解决方案三:平台是VS2003,framework1.0的解决方案四:ASPOSE.WORDS组件.不过起码是2.0的解决方案五:引用3楼wjq的回复: ASPOSE.WORDS组件.不过起码是2.0的 是的,所以正苦恼着,升级系统平台更是麻烦的事,问问还有没有其他办法呢解决方案六:http://npoi.codeplex.com/解决方案七:引用5楼wuwanchunIT的回复: htt

求助!ASP.NET后台代码生成word乱码问题!!!

问题描述 之前电脑里面装的是office2003这样的代码是没问题的.后来换了office2007发现生成后word的内容变成了乱码请问要怎么修改呢?!求解决....BinaryReaderbReader=newBinaryReader(Request.InputStream);stringstrTemp=System.Text.Encoding.GetEncoding("iso-8859-1").GetString(bReader.ReadBytes((int)bReader.Bas

ASP.NET生成静态HTML页面的方法

环境:Microsoft .NET Framework SDK v1.1 OS:Windows Server 2003 中文版 ASP.Net生成静态HTML页 在Asp中实现的生成静态页用到的FileSystemObject对象! 在.Net中涉及此类操作的是System.IO 以下是程序代码 注:此代码非原创!参考别人代码 //生成HTML页 环境:Microsoft .NET Framework SDK v1.1 OS:Windows Server 2003 中文版 ASP.Net生成静态

教你用Asp.NET 生成静态页

asp.net|静态     环境:Microsoft .NET Framework SDK v1.1 OS:Windows Server 2003 中文版ASP.Net生成静态HTML页在Asp中实现的生成静态页用到的FileSystemObject对象!     在.Net中涉及此类操作的是System.IO以下是程序代码 注:此代码非原创!参考别人代码     CODE://生成HTML页public static bool WriteFile(string strText,string